AI's Impact on Sustainable Building Design

parametric-architecture.com

The piece explores how AI optimizes construction workflows, reduces waste, and powers adaptive smart buildings. Real-world examples like Google's Bay View Campus and Masdar City are showcasing the powerful potential of AI in sustainable architecture.

The Parks Eco-Village

designboom.com

Stolon Studio's project in Herefordshire, UK transforms a former dairy farm into eight energy-efficient homes, demonstrating adaptive reuse, showcasing how thoughtful design can revitalize neglected structures.

Designer-Led Circular Economy Initiatives

archpaper.com

Three innovators highlighted: MIC repurposes salvaged materials and trains deconstruction experts. CCL's software measures and optimizes material circularity in design phases. Assemblage focuses on material provenance and ecological loops.

Sustainable Construction Materials

autodesk.com

Innovations include bendable concrete with CO2, mass timber for carbon sequestration, 3D-printed concrete, mycelium-based blocks, and carbon nanotubes pushing construction boundaries.
